I am attaching an example as to
how I approached
historiography kind of
questions:
Download link
4. Every year one question
purely on culture and religion .
Eg
Q1. The Upanishadic
principles embody the epitome
of the Vedic thought. Discuss.
(UPSC 2014)
Q2. Give a brief account of the
early medieval temple
architecture of Katnmir. (UPSC
2015)
Q3. Why is Mamallapuram
famous? (UPSC 2015)
Here is a link as to how I
prepared architecture kind of
http://www.insightsonindia.com/2016/05/20/optional-strategy-history-gazal-bharadwaj-rank-40-cse-2015/

13/26

11/28/2016

OPTIONAL STRATEGY: History - by Gazal Bharadwaj, Rank - 40, CSE - 2015 - INSIGHTS

questions:
Download link
5. Every year something on
gender. Eg
Q1.Social norms for women in
the Dharmasastra and
Arthasashtra tradition where
framed in accordance with the
Varnashrama tradition.
Evaluate critically. (UPSC
2013)
Q2.Tantrism, if not in practice,
at least on conceptual level
challenged patriarchy;
Examine Tantrism specially
keeping in mind the above
context.(UPSC 2015)juxtaposing religion and gender
Q3. analyze the steps taken
Razia Sultan by to strengthen
our position as an independent
ruler despite various obstacles.
(UPSC 2013)
Q4. Bhakti and Mysticism of
Lal Ded emerged as a social
force in Kashmir. Comment.
(UPSC 2013)
